LUSH Gorilla Perfume in Vanillary review


          I've gone bananas vanillas over LUSH Gorilla Perfume in Vanillary. I'm an absolute vanilla fanatic and can oft be found sniffing the Vanilla extract bottle come baking season. The fact that I picked Vanillary as one of my two favorite scents during a blind fragrance chooser test at LUSH is a no-brainer. (My other one favorite was Tuca Tuca). After dreaming about this scent for months, I finally have my own little Vanillary spritzer to share with you today!

         Vanilla is the ultimate gourmand scent. Natural vanilla absolute is mixed with a touch of sandalwood and burnt caramel notes for an absolutely delicious experience. The vanilla is a deeper vanilla, like the one you would get from a real, not synthetic extract. A hint of floral jasmine and tonka bean give femininity to an otherwise foodie scent. What I get overall is a well rounded warm vanilla pudding dessert with a hint of floral. It's delicious and gorgeous rolled into one. Vanillary has good lasting power and seems to develop with my natural warmth. The product is both cruelty free and vegan. It's also worth noting that the long black pen shape of the spritzer is very gorilla guerilla. You could slip it easily into a clutch or pocket for a night out.

        With LUSH Gorilla Perfume in Vanillary, I can have my dessert and smell like it too.  I'll definitely be slipping Vanillary into my purse, especially as the cooler months come in. LUSH Vanillary perfume is available in Spritzer form (shown, $24.95 for 0.3 oz.), as well as a solid and larger 1.0 oz spray. Thanks for reading!
